The swampy region of Suncheon Bay expands in to the downstream place at which Dong-cheon and Isa-cheon satisfy, supplying the swampy land. The velocity of the current rises from the raising slope, plus the land extends downstream. The swampy land, unique to Korea, is preserved in view of its purely natural ecology.
